Default The Fodder Shop, Lowestoft

If you live anywhere near Lowestoft it's worth popping into The Fodder Shop which is in Nightingale Road. They have tortoises for sale (Hermann's) which are in a huge tortoise table, not in vivariums. They have tortoise tables for sale and lots of other accessories and books. The people there are also very knowledgeable and friendly. They are opening an online shop soon so when they do I will let you know.
